引言
在数字化时代,智能应用的开发已成为推动社会进步的重要力量。然而,编程技能的门槛一度成为普通人参与智能应用开发的障碍。近年来,随着技术的不断发展,无代码和低代码开发平台的兴起,打破了编程壁垒,使得无需编程也能轻松实现智能应用成为可能。
无代码开发平台简介
无代码开发平台是一种可视化编程工具,用户通过拖拽组件、设置参数和规则,即可构建应用程序。这类平台降低了开发门槛,使得不具备编程背景的用户也能参与应用开发。
主要特点:
- 可视化操作:用户无需编写代码,通过图形界面进行操作,降低学习成本。
- 组件化开发:提供丰富的组件库,涵盖功能、界面、数据等方面,满足多样化需求。
- 快速迭代:支持快速原型设计,方便用户不断优化和改进应用。
低代码开发平台简介
低代码开发平台介于无代码和传统编程之间,提供部分可视化开发功能,同时保留一定程度的编程操作。这类平台适用于具有一定编程基础的用户。
主要特点:
- 可视化编程:通过图形界面进行编程,提高开发效率。
- 代码生成:平台自动生成部分代码,降低编写工作量。
- 模块化开发:提供丰富的模块和组件,便于快速搭建应用。
无需编程也能实现智能应用的实例
以下列举几个无需编程也能实现智能应用的实例:
- 企业内部应用:如人事管理系统、财务管理软件等,可通过无代码开发平台快速搭建。
- 移动应用开发:如微信小程序、手机APP等,低代码开发平台可满足开发需求。
- 物联网应用:如智能家居、智能设备等,无代码开发平台可简化开发过程。
如何选择合适的平台
选择合适的无代码或低代码开发平台,需要考虑以下因素:
- 应用类型:根据应用类型选择适合的平台,如企业内部应用、移动应用等。
- 功能需求:考虑应用所需功能,选择功能丰富的平台。
- 易用性:选择操作简单、易于上手的平台。
- 社区支持:关注平台社区,了解用户反馈和解决方案。
总结
随着技术的发展,无需编程也能轻松实现智能应用成为现实。无代码和低代码开发平台的兴起,为普通人参与智能应用开发提供了便利。未来,随着技术的不断进步,将有更多创新的应用诞生,推动社会进步。